Key Responsibilities

As a Client Data Analyst, your primary responsibilities will include: • Collaborating with stakeholders to gather and comprehend business requirements concerning data reporting. • Designing, formatting, and delivering reports that precisely meet business needs while ensuring accuracy and consistency. • Ensuring adherence to industry regulations and internal policies relevant to data reporting. • Documenting processes, configurations, and procedures within the reporting function to ensure clear and current records. • Implementing automation strategies to enhance efficiency in data analysis and reporting. • Utilizing Business Intelligence (BI) platforms to create advanced data flows and comprehensive dashboards for presentations. • Applying best practices for navigating and publishing BI reports, managing permissions, and tracking usage by data users. • Assisting data teams in querying, structuring, and modeling data for reports and dashboards using programming languages. • Analyzing business data to create descriptive, diagnostic, and predictive reports with advanced visuals to uncover trends and insights. • Mentoring team members on data visualization best practices and facilitating their growth in report development. • Conducting testing with business partners and recommending enhancements to dashboards and reports. Required Skills To excel in this role, candidates should possess: • Proficiency in SQL and JavaScript for database development and analysis. • Experience with Oracle and other database systems. • A robust understanding of database design best practices and compliance regulations concerning data security. • The ability to create and maintain clear, concise documentation for database procedures and designs. • Experience in managing benefit functions and processing checks. • A sharp eye for identifying and rectifying data discrepancies utilizing appropriate tools. • Familiarity with data monitoring tools for tracking and enhancing data processes. • Proven capability to automate data management tasks to bolster efficiency. • Experience in generating reports and presentations that effectively communicate data insights to stakeholders. • Knowledge of company policies and regulations to ensure compliance in data management. • Excellent analytical skills for interpreting and understanding data trends.

Qualifications

Candidates should preferably possess: • A bachelor’s degree in a relevant field. • Relevant certifications may be considered a plus. • Proven experience in data analysis or reporting roles with a successful track record of project delivery and stakeholder collaboration.
